Plastic Versus Cotton Caps for Preventing Hypothermia in Very Preterm Infants: A Randomized Clinical Trial

Insights
Plastic caps, combined with polyethylene body wrapping, slightly increased admission temperatures in very preterm infants compared to cotton caps. However, neither cap type significantly reduced hypothermia rates, indicating a need for novel strategies, especially for extremely preterm infants.

Objective:
Preventing hypothermia in very preterm infants is difficult. This study aims to compare the effect of plastic versus cotton caps in combination with polyethylene body wrapping in the prevention of hypothermia in very preterm infants.
Materials And Methods:
A total of 95 newborns less than 32 weeks of gestation were enrolled in this randomized clinical trial. Immediately after birth, the infants were placed in polyethylene covers. In the intervention group (n=48), the heads of newborns were covered with plastic caps, while in the control group (n=47), the heads were covered with cotton caps. The primary outcomes were temperature at admission and 1 hour after admission in the neonatal intensive care unit, as well as the rate of hypothermia in both groups.
Results:
Mean axillary temperature on admission was higher in the plastic cap group compared to the cotton cap group (P = .009). After adjusting for gestational age, the difference in mean admission temperature was higher in the plastic cap group in the 28-31 weeks' gestation (P = .013); however, all babies born at 25-27 weeks' gestation remained hypothermic at neonatal intensive care unit admission. The temperature 1 hour after admission was similar between the groups (P=.846). The rate of hypothermia showed no significant difference between groups.
Conclusion:
Although plastic caps were associated with higher admission temperatures compared with cotton caps, they did not reduce the frequency of hypothermia. This points to the need for newer and combined strategies, especially in extremely preterm infants (25-27 weeks). Plastic caps remain a cost-effective and hygienic option for resource-limited settings. Trial registration: The trial was prospectively registered in the Iranian Registry of Clinical Trials (IRCT) under the registration number IRCT20091201002801N5 on February 9, 2023.
